为了账号安全,请及时绑定邮箱和手机立即绑定

vue实现原理

很多同学在进行编程学习时缺乏系统学习的资料。本页面基于vue实现原理内容,从基础理论到综合实战,通过实用的知识类文章,标准的编程教程,丰富的视频课程,为您在vue实现原理相关知识领域提供全面立体的资料补充。同时还包含 vagrant、val、validationgroup 的知识内容,欢迎查阅!

vue实现原理相关知识

  • 深入Vue实现原理,实现一个响应式框架
    如果大家有过 Vue 的开发经验的话, 那么相信大家都已经对 Vue 响应式数据渲染 的功能不陌生了,那么Vue是如何实现响应式数据渲染的呢?如果我们也想开发一个能够支持响应式数据渲染的库,那么我们应该怎么做呢?这就是我们本文章的主要内容。 在本文章中我们会和大家一起去实现一个响应式的框架 -- MVue,MVue 会遵循Vue的代码逻辑和实现思路,我们希望能够借助MVue来让大家更好的理解整个Vue的核心思想:响应式数据渲染。 在开始我们的MVue开发之前,我们需要先了解一些必备的知识
  • Vue源码——nextTick实现原理
    前言在上一篇专栏讲到订阅者的响应是先把订阅者添加到一个队列,然后再 nextTick 函数中去遍历这个队列,对每个订阅者进行响应处理。大家所熟悉的 Vue API Vue.nextTick 全局方法和 vm.$nextTick 实例方法的内部都是调用 nextTick 函数,该函数的作用可以理解为异步执行传入的函数。一、Vue.nextTick 内部逻辑在执行 initGlobalAPI(Vue) 初始化 Vue 全局 API 中,这么定义 Vue.nextTick。function initGlobalAPI(Vue) { //... Vue.nextTick = nextTick; }复制代码可以看出是直接把 nextTick 函数赋值给 Vue.nextTick,就可以了,非常简单。二、vm.$nextTick 内部逻辑Vue.prototype.$nextTick = function (fn) { return nextTick(fn, this) };复制代码可以看出是 vm.$nextT
  • Vue的一点原理
    现代主流框架均使用一种数据=>视图的方式,隐藏了繁琐的dom操作,采用了声明式编程(Declarative Programming)替代了过去的类jquery的命令式编程(Imperative Programming)。我一直找不到合适的语言来描述以上的观念,这句话的出现正中我心。Maybe可以说Vue的学习可以分为四个阶段:会使用基本的语法(大概半天就学会了)可以使用一些更加复杂的特性(经历了大量的工作实践)懂得vue的原理读懂vue的源码,甚至还可以自己造一个vue当然,可能我还在第二个阶段,第四个阶段也是我臆想的2333 当然也可以边看源码边学习原理的啊现在我在看一些关于vue原理的东西,希望这篇文章可以记录我学到的知识和我的思考。数据响应原理这张图来自vue的官方文档,文档中讲:当你把一个普通的 JavaScript 对象传给 Vue 实例的 data 选项,Vue 将遍历此对象所有的属性,并使用 Object.defineProperty 把这些属性全部转为 getter/setter。这些
  • 详解Vue响应式原理
    摘要: 搞懂Vue响应式原理! 作者:浪里行舟 原文:深入浅出Vue响应式原理 Fundebug经授权转载,版权归原作者所有。 前言 Vue 最独特的特性之一,是其非侵入性的响应式系统。数据模型仅仅是普通的 JavaScript 对象。而当你修改它们时,视图会进行更新。这使得状态管理非常简单直接,不过理解其工作原理同样重要,这样你可以避开一些常见的问题。----官方文档 本文将针对响应式原理做一个详细介绍,并且带你实现一个基础版的响应式系统。本文的代码请猛戳Github博客 什么是响应式 我

vue实现原理相关课程

vue实现原理相关教程

vue实现原理相关搜索

查看更多慕课网实用课程

意见反馈 帮助中心 APP下载
官方微信